1

noun

Meaning 1

A serous membrane that surrounds the heart allowing it to contract.

Definition source: English Wiktionary via Wiktextract

Topics: anatomy, cardiology, medicine, sciences

2

noun

Meaning 2

a serous membrane with two layers that surrounds the heart

Definition source: Princeton WordNet 3.0

History

Etymology

Learned borrowing from Ancient Greek περικάρδιον (perikárdion).
